As the sun rises, the UV Index begins its ascent, starting at a low 1 at 07:00 and gradually climbing to 10 by 11:00, which marks the peak of solar intensity. By 12:00, it reaches a high of 11, signaling the need for protective measures against harmful UV rays. As the afternoon progresses, the index dips to 9 at 13:00 and continues to decline, dropping to 4 by 15:00. By 16:00, it further lessens to 2, and as the day winds down, it falls to 1 by 17:00 and plummets to 0 by 18:00. With the UV Index effectively diminishing post-noon, this data highlights the importance of sun safety during peak hours when UV exposure is at its highest.
Time | UVI | Category | Time to Burn |
---|---|---|---|
07:00 | 1 | low | 45 min |
08:00 | 3 | moderate | 30 min |
09:00 | 6 | high | 25 min |
10:00 | 8 | very high | 15 min |
11:00 | 10 | very high | 15 min |
12:00 | 11 | extreme | 10 min |
13:00 | 9 | very high | 15 min |
14:00 | 6 | high | 25 min |
15:00 | 4 | moderate | 30 min |
16:00 | 2 | low | 45 min |
17:00 | 1 | low | 45 min |
18:00 | 0 | low | 45 min |
19:00 | 0 | low | 45 min |
The UV Index in this region shows extreme levels consistently throughout the year, with particularly high values from January to April and again from October to November, where the index peaks at 16. March and February are notable high-risk months, maintaining a UV Index of 16. Visitors and residents should exercise caution and ensure protective measures are in place, including wearing sunscreen, protective clothing, and sunglasses, as the burn time is a mere 10 minutes across all months. It's essential to limit sun exposure, especially during these high-risk months, to prevent skin damage.
